Notes The beginning of the manuscript: In the name of God, the Most Gracious, the Most Merciful (...) As for praising God, who exalted the status of the people of literature and extracted from the seas of their thoughtful thoughts what qualifies him to be amazed (...) these are thirty chapters that were long, eloquent, and originally good, containing words that were more delicate than comprehensive, and meanings in the eyes of their scholars that mesmerized the minds (...) and they were named, since they took hold of the reins of kindness, the breeze of youth. The end of the manuscript: This is the last thing uttered by the tongue of the firefly, and the good news that Nassim al-Sabbah reported on the ears has ended (...) It has been completed, praise be to God (...) And of course, he liked it when you were blessed with *** Nassim al-Sabbah, and I liked the printing of his pages. End. Font type: Moroccan
